Currituck Beach Lighthouse

The Currituck Beach Light is a lighthouse located on the Outer Banks in Corolla, North Carolina. The Currituck Beach Light was added to the National Register of Historic Places on October 15, 1973.

Whalehead Club

The Historic Whalehead Club is a large 21,000-square-foot home located on a remote tract facing the Currituck Sound.

Corolla Wild Horse Museum

The Wild Horse Museum provides free information about the wild Spanish mustangs that roam the northern beaches of the Currituck Outer Banks, NC.

Water's Edge Village School

WEVS - pronounced "waves" is a public, K-8, charter school in Corolla, NC. In its 13th year, WEVS hosts 50 students and a staff of seven.
